This week, Xyla’s Healthier You: NHS Diabetes Prevention Programme received its 850,000th referral since the company started running the programme in 2016. 

About the programme

In a typical month, Xyla receives around 10,000 referrals to the programme from GP surgeries and individuals across England. The free programme is open to those who have been diagnosed as prediabetic (this means having a raised blood glucose level) or who had diabetes during pregnancy (also known as gestational diabetes). The programme is delivered face-to-face or online via an app. Remote groups are also available via Teams for those with hearing difficulties and in a range of languages including Hindi, Punjabi and Gujurati. 

Last year the company ran a total of 1680 face-to-face groups across the country, each with an average of about 15-25 service users. The groups are led by qualified and experienced Health and Wellbeing Coaches and extend for 13 sessions over nine months. Each session lasts an hour and a half and covers topics such as diet, exercise, stress management and sleep.

Naomi Jones, Head of Diabetes Services at Xyla, comments: “We are incredibly proud to have received our 850,000th referral, marking an astonishing milestone. The Healthier You: NHS Diabetes Prevention Programme is a world-leading preventative health initiative. By participating in the programme, individuals diagnosed with prediabetes and those with a history of gestational diabetes give themselves the best possible chance of preventing the onset of type 2 diabetes. This is crucial as type 2 diabetes can lead to severe complications such as heart disease, stroke, vision loss, kidney failure, nerve damage, and amputations.” 

She continues: “Our programme is delivered by dedicated coaches who are passionate about health. They assist service users in overcoming barriers that often prevent people from making sustainable lifestyle changes. Making referrals

Those with prediabetes can be referred to the programme by their GP. If they have their blood glucose, or HbA1c, reading and it was taken within the last 12 months and is between 42–47 mmol/mol, they can refer themselves here, or they can call us on 0333 5773010. Those who have a history of gestational diabetes are at higher risk of type two diabetes. Up to 50% of women diagnosed with gestational diabetes go on to develop type 2 diabetes within five years. They do not need a blood test to join the programme and can refer themselves here or call us on the number above (they should state that they have a history of gestational diabetes). 

Regions we cover

Xyla runs the Healthier You: NHS Diabetes Prevention Programme in 15 Integrated Care Boards across England, including:

  • Bath, North East Somerset, Swindon and Wiltshire
  • Bedford, Luton and Milton Keynes
  • Coventry and Warwickshire
  • Devon
  • Frimley
  • Gloucestershire
  • Hampshire and Isle of Wight
  • Humber Coast and Vale
  • Leicester, Leicestershire and Rutland
  • Lincolnshire
  • Mid and South Essex
  • Norwich and Waveney
  • Somerset
  • Suffolk and North East Essex
  • Sussex
